Choosing the Best Mask for Your Run

Running outside is great exercise. Sometimes, though, you need a mask. Whether it’s for dusty trails, cold weather, or city air, the right mask makes your run better. This guide helps you find that perfect mask.

What to Look for in a Running Mask (Key Features)

When you shop for a running mask, keep these important things in mind:

Breathability
  • The mask should let you breathe easily. You don’t want to feel like you’re suffocating.
  • Look for masks with vents or special fabrics that allow air to pass through.
Fit and Comfort
  • A good mask stays in place. It shouldn’t slip down when you’re running hard.
  • Check for adjustable ear loops or a snug fit around your nose and mouth.
  • Soft materials are also important so the mask doesn’t rub or irritate your skin.
Protection
  • What do you need protection from? Dust? Wind? Cold?
  • Some masks offer UV protection for sunny days.
  • Others are designed to block out allergens or pollution.
Durability
  • You want a mask that lasts. It should hold up to washing and regular use.
  • Strong stitching and good quality fabric are signs of a durable mask.
Visibility
  • If the mask covers your eyes or nose, make sure it doesn’t block your view.
  • You need to see where you are going, especially on busy trails or roads.

Important Materials for Running Masks

The fabric of your mask matters a lot. Here are some common and good materials:

  • Polyester and Spandex Blends: These are popular because they are stretchy and dry quickly. They feel smooth against your skin.
  • Nylon: This material is strong and lightweight. It also dries fast.
  • Cotton: Some people like cotton because it’s soft. However, it can hold moisture and feel heavy when wet. It’s better for cooler, less intense runs.
  • Neoprene: This is a thicker material, often used for cold weather. It keeps you warm but can be less breathable.
  • Specialty Fabrics: Some masks use advanced materials that wick away sweat or filter air.

What Makes a Running Mask Better (or Worse)?

Many things can change how good a running mask is for you.

Quality Boosters
  • Adjustable Nose Wire: This helps the mask fit snugly around your nose, preventing glasses from fogging up.
  • Moisture-Wicking Properties: Fabrics that pull sweat away from your skin keep you drier and more comfortable.
  • Antimicrobial Treatments: Some masks have special coatings to help prevent odors and keep the mask cleaner.
  • Multiple Layers: For better filtering, masks often have several layers of fabric.
Quality Reducers
  • Poor Stitching: Loose threads or weak seams can make a mask fall apart quickly.
  • Non-Breathable Materials: If the fabric doesn’t let air through, it makes running very difficult.
  • Bad Fit: A mask that’s too tight or too loose is uncomfortable and won’t protect you well.
  • Rough Textures: Scratchy or stiff materials can chafe your skin during a run.

Your Experience and When to Use a Running Mask

Think about how you’ll use the mask.

  • Trail Running: You might need a mask to keep dust and debris out of your mouth and nose. Look for good filtering.
  • Cold Weather Running: A mask can keep your face warm and protect it from the biting wind. Neoprene or thicker fabrics work well here.
  • City Running: If you run in a busy city, a mask can help filter out pollution.
  • Allergy Season: For runners with pollen allergies, a mask can be a lifesaver.

A mask should feel like a second skin, not a burden. It should help you enjoy your run more, no matter the conditions.


Frequently Asked Questions About Running Masks

Q: Do I really need a mask for running?

A: You might need one for protection from dust, cold, pollution, or allergens. It depends on where and when you run.

Q: What is the most breathable material for a running mask?

A: Lightweight polyester and spandex blends are usually very breathable. They also dry fast.

Q: How do I make sure my running mask fits well?

A: Look for adjustable ear loops or a strap that goes around your head. A snug fit is key. It should cover your nose and mouth without slipping.

Q: Will a mask make it hard to breathe when I run?

A: A good running mask is designed to be breathable. If it feels too hard to breathe, it might not be the right mask for you.

Q: Can I wear my glasses with a running mask?

A: Yes, many masks are designed to work with glasses. Look for masks with an adjustable nose wire to help prevent fogging.

Q: How often should I wash my running mask?

A: You should wash your mask after every use, just like your running clothes, to keep it clean and fresh.

Q: Are there masks specifically for cold weather running?

A: Yes, some masks are made of thicker materials like neoprene to provide extra warmth and wind protection.

Q: What’s the difference between a fashion mask and a running mask?

A: Running masks are made with breathable, moisture-wicking fabrics and are designed for a secure fit during exercise.

Q: Can a running mask protect me from viruses?

A: Some masks offer protection, but it’s important to check the mask’s specifications. For medical protection, consult health guidelines.
